Tribune News Service

Jalandhar, December 18

A patwari posted in Banga was held red-handed by a Vigilance team while accepting a bribe of Rs 10,000.

The accused has been identified as Amardeep Singh.

Tajinder Singh of Gobindpur village had lodged a complaint with the Vigilance Bureau that the accused had demanded Rs 20,000 in lieu of registering an ancestral land in his name. After the complaint, the team laid a trap and arrested Amardeep.

A case under the Prevention of Corruption Act has been registered against him.
